Spicy Cajun Chicken Sloppy Joes Recipe

Spicy Cajun Chicken Sloppy Joes

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 5 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b (454 g) ground chicken
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 small onion, diced
  • 1 small green bell pepper, diced
  • 1 small red bell pepper, diced
  • 3 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1.5 tbsps Cajun seasoning (store-bought or homemade)
  • 0.5 tsp smoked paprika
  • 0.5 cup ketchup
  • 2 tbsps tomato paste
  • 1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 tsp hot sauce (optional, for extra heat)
  • 0.5 cup chicken broth
  • 1 tsp brown sugar (optional, for a touch of sweetness)
  • 4 hamburger buns, toasted
  • Optional toppings: sliced pickles, coleslaw, shredded cheese

Instructions

  1. Sear and Brown: Heat a large skillet over medium-high flame, drizzle olive oil, and thoroughly crumble ground chicken until evenly cooked and golden brown.
  2. Vegetable Infusion: Add diced onions, green and red bell peppers, and minced garlic to the skillet, sautéing until vegetables become translucent and release their aromatic qualities.
  3. Spice Awakening: Sprinkle Cajun seasoning and smoked paprika across the mixture, gently toasting spices to unlock their deep, complex flavor profiles.
  4. Sauce Composition: Reduce skillet temperature and pour in ketchup, tomato paste, Worcestershire sauce, hot sauce, chicken broth, and brown sugar, stirring until the sauce thickens and integrates harmoniously.
  5. Seasoning Refinement: Adjust salt and spice levels, ensuring a balanced interplay between heat and sweetness that complements the Cajun-inspired sauce.
  6. Bun Preparation: Lightly toast buns to create a crisp base that will support the robust chicken mixture without becoming soggy.
  7. Plating and Garnish: Generously pile the spicy chicken mixture onto toasted buns, optionally adorning with pickles, coleslaw, or melted cheese for additional texture and flavor.
  8. Serving Suggestion: Present immediately with accompanying sides like crispy fries, crunchy chips, or a fresh salad to complete the meal.

Notes

  • Spice Control: Adjust Cajun seasoning based on heat tolerance; start with less and gradually add more to prevent overwhelming spiciness.
  • Meat Texture Tip: Break ground chicken into extremely fine pieces while browning to ensure even cooking and better sauce absorption.
  • Sauce Consistency Hack: Simmer sauce slowly to develop deeper flavors and achieve desired thickness; longer cooking creates richer taste profile.
  • Dietary Modification: For gluten-free version, use gluten-free buns and verify Worcestershire sauce is wheat-free; for low-carb option, serve over cauliflower rice or lettuce wraps instead of traditional buns.
